"Using a Powerball won't improve grip strength for a climber. However it does appear to tone the opposing muscles (extensors) on the back of the forearm, so it may be of benefit for injury prevention. Long sessions (>20 mins)alternating hands (1 min each) may improve capillary density in the forearms. Additionally, last year I had some soreness and stiffness in the finger joints. A few minutes with a Powerball provided instant relief, whereas similar easy exercise sqeezing a soft ball did not. Possibly something to do with the vibration perhaps."
